From: Markus Armbruster Date: Fri, 21 Feb 2014 15:42:52 +0000 (+0100) Subject: vnc: Fix tight_detect_smooth_image() for lossless case X-Git-Url: http://git.osdn.net/view?a=commitdiff_plain;h=2e7bcdb99adbd8fc10ad9ddcf93bd2bf3c0f1f2d;p=qmiga%2Fqemu.git vnc: Fix tight_detect_smooth_image() for lossless case VncTight member uint8_t quality is either (uint8_t)-1 for lossless or less than 10 for lossy. tight_detect_smooth_image() first promotes it to int, then compares with -1. Always unequal, so we always execute the lossy code. Reads beyond tight_conf[] and returns crap when quality is actually lossless. Compare to (uint8_t)-1 instead, like we do elsewhere. Spotted by Coverity.
